> Next Monday, 17th of December, at 18:30 the Haifa Linux Club, will gather to
> Eli Billauer's lecture about
> 
>             High-end Video Editing with Cinelerra
> 
> Cinelerra is a high-end video editing tool for creation of
> professional-looking videos and clips, targeting video share sites as
> well as making DVDs. This no-slides presentation is a walkthrough of
> the process of making an edited video: Importing raw video, two-screen
> editing, tweaking the edits, image insertion, transitions, gradual
> effects and finally rendering. No previous Linux knowledge or
> experience is needed, nor is it necessary to install Linux to use
> Cinelerra, thanks to a LiveCD (dynebolic), on which the demonstration
> is based.
